Transaction ef2137bb485c1d3cbb08b5e3af5023c348f5156104431868c56c0db52a1f7ac1

38 Input
1 Outputs
  • ef2137bb485c1d3cbb08b5e3af5023c348f5156104431868c56c0db52a1f7ac1:0
  • value  164181463
    address  bc1qn9t533svgyhlxulgu0qe5d6sgvmcdd7wgehdvz